English: Plate 97. Fig. 1. Asparagopsis Svedelii. A portion of a plant to show the delicate habit, x 1.3. Fig. 2. Dasya Stanfordiana. A portion of a well-developed tetrasporangial plant to show the habit. I. Espanola. x 1.3. [= syn. of Dasya pedicellata subsp. stanfordiana (Farlow) J.N.Norris & Bucher; Dasya pedicellata is a synonym of Dasya baillouviana (S.G.Gmelin) Montagne, AlgaeBase] |
